Abstract

A pair of goggles against dazzling by the sun and snow is proposed which enable the wearer of the goggles to have the incident light beams individually filtered out. By means of two polarisation films arranged one behind another in the eye pieces, one polarisation film being functionally connected in each case in a rotary fashion to a centrally arranged wheel, the polarising grids of the polarisation films are more or less superimposed by rotating the wheel, so that in use the absorption can be regulated by the wearer of the goggles.
